About Blagoevgrad

Blagoevgrad lies in the valley of the Struma river that separates the ruggedRilaandPirinranges from the mountains on the western border. Blagoevgrad Province (Oblast) extends from the city itself all the way down to the border withGreece,80km (50mi)to the south. It covers the southern slopes of Rila and the whole of Pirin, includingBansko,RazlogandGotse Delchevin the mountains andSandanski,PetrichandMelnikdown the Struma Valley. Theoblastalso mostly overlaps with Pirin Macedonia, the Bulgarian part of Macedonia - the historical-geographic region that was the cause of much bloodshed in the 20th century and political bickering in the 21st.
